According to the authorities in Sana’a, the Yemeni capital, two revolutionaries would have set themselves on fire to protest against political factions ‘manipulation of the revolution.
Abdullah Ahmad Ghalib Baidhani and Anwar Azazi poured gasoline on their heads before lighting themselves up in “Change Square”, the main rallying point of the uprising which is mainly under the control of al-Islah, Yemen’s Islamic faction.
Allegedly, the Yemen Observer could not independently confirm the reports, the two men wanted to establish their opposition of al-Islah, which they said disrupted the real revolutionary movement through oppression and repression as its members wanted to seize power.
Such claims have often been uttered by activists in the square.
Both men were taken to the Square’s hospital for treatment.
